Navigating EU Sustainability Regulations

Since 2021, the Single-Use Plastics Directive (SUPD) has banned a wide range of plastic items including straws, plates, and cutlery. In 2025, the Packaging and Packaging Waste Regulation (PPWR) came into effect, introducing even stricter rules that promote recyclability, reusability, and safe materials in food-contact packaging.

These regulations apply directly to the HoReCa sector, which uses millions of straws every day. While many businesses quickly switched to paper or PLA alternatives, these often come with problems:

  • Paper straws become soggy within minutes, often needing to be replaced multiple times per guest.

  • PLA straws don’t biodegrade in nature and are difficult to recycle.

  • Many products contain PFAS or synthetic glues that break down into harmful microplastics.


A Compliant, Durable Alternative

The Ocean Straw is fully aligned with EU regulations. It’s made in Spain using bio-based, biodegradable material sourced from Finland—with no trees cut in the process. The material is created from wood dust (a side stream from industrial production) and other responsibly sourced, compostable ingredients.

  • ✅ PFAS-free and allergen-free

  • ♻️ Compostable and industrially recyclable

  • 🥛 Maintains its structure in hot and cold drinks

  • ☕ Dishwasher-safe up to 10 cycles at 60°C

This makes The Ocean Straw a long-lasting, safe, and convenient alternative that performs like conventional plastic, without its environmental cost.
